Economic Development and Logistics Performance: The Impact of Human Development and Economic Growth on a Country’s Logistics Performance: Evidence from the EU Member States
Our study aims to identify the influence that both economic growth and human development have on the logistics performance of the EU member states. When discussing the economic development of a country, the human and economic growth components tend to be separated. This research aims to fill this gap by integrating both perspectives into the comprehensive variable of economic development. Utilising a linear regression model, the study uses as independent variables, the human development index and the GDP per capita (as the main indicator for economic growth), while the logistics performance index (LPI) is considered the dependent variable. Based on the results, both independent variables of the model explain up to 54% of the variation of the LPI in the EU member states (plus Switzerland). Furthermore, the results of the research indicate that the strongest correlation is identified between the human development index and logistics performance index (0.73). The study explores how economic growth and advancements in human development metrics enhance the efficiency and effectiveness of national logistics systems. Findings suggest that broader economic and human development conditions are associated with stronger logistics performance, as reflected in the composite LPI measure. Furthermore, human development – assessed via education, health, and social welfare – arises as a crucial factor influencing logistics performance, underscoring the importance of human capital in facilitating sustainable transportation and trade systems. The results highlight the significance of combining economic and social development strategies with logistics policies to improve competitiveness and connectivity in the EU.
